Connect with us

Information Technology (IT)

BSc Information Technology (IT) Course: Colleges, Career, Jobs, Salary and FAQs [2025 Guide]

Photo of Pratik Singh

Updated on

BSc Information Technology Degree - A Step by Step Guide

Starting a BSc in Information Technology is a great step. It helps you enter the exciting world of computers and tech. In this easy guide, we will tell you all about this course. You will learn about the subjects and who can apply. You will discover job options and top colleges. So, let’s begin and explore this fun and growing field.

 

What is a BSc in Information Technology?

A BSc in Information Technology is a 3-year college course. It teaches you about computers and software. You will learn how to build apps and manage data.

This course helps you get ready for jobs in the IT world. You will learn the skills needed for today’s tech jobs.

Why is BSc Information Technology Important? Today, everything uses technology. So, a degree in Information Technology is useful.

It helps you work in fields like software, data security, and system handling. Because tech is used everywhere, this degree gives you many job choices. That’s why it is a smart choice for your future.

Who Should Choose BSc Information Technology? This course is best for students who love computers. If you like coding and using software, this course is for you. It is great for solving problems.

When Should You Start This Course? Most students join this course after Class 12. But some may take more time and decide later.

You can choose this course if you love tech or want to build new software. If you want to help companies grow with technology, this course is for you. It’s a great choice.

 

BSc Information Technology – What You Will Learn

The BSc Information Technology course covers computers and software. It has clear goals to teach important skills. Let’s look at the main things you will learn:

  • Software Development – You will learn how to write code and build software.

  • Networking – You will understand how computers talk to each other.

  • Database Management – You will learn how to save and use data in smart ways.

  • Cybersecurity – Learn to protect computers from online threats.

  • System Analysis and Design – You will learn to understand problems. You wills develop tech solutions.

These skills will help you become ready for jobs in the tech world.

 

BSc Information Technology: Course Highlights

Aspect Details
Full Form Bachelor of Science in Information Technology
Course Level Undergraduate
Course Duration 3 years
Eligibility 10+2 with Mathematics or Computer Science as core subjects
Course Fee INR 50,000 to 2,00,000 per annum (varies by institution)
Examination Type Semester-based
Admission Process Merit-based selection or entrance exams
Average Salary After Degree INR 3.5 lakh to 9 lakh per annum (entry-level)
Recruiting Companies IT companies, Software Development firms, Tech startups

 

BSc Information Technology – How Long is the Course?

The BSc Information Technology course is full-time 3 years. It is split into many parts, so learning becomes easy.

In the first year, you will learn the basics. You will start with things like coding, databases, and computer networks.

This step-by-step way helps you learn better and makes you ready for the tech world.

 

BSc Information Technology Course Eligibility Criteria:

To join a BSc Information Technology course, you must meet some simple rules. These rules help colleges choose the right students. Let’s look at them:

  • Academic Qualification: You must pass your 10+2 exam. Or something similar from a known school board.

  • Stream of Study: You must study Maths or Computer Science in 10+2.

  • Marks: Most colleges ask for 50% to 60% marks. This helps check if you have a strong base in maths and computers.

So, if you meet these rules, you can apply for this course. Check the college’s required marks before applying.

 

BSc Information Technology Course Admission Process:

Getting admission to BSc Information Technology is simple. But they may change a bit from one college to another. But, most colleges follow these steps:

  • Application: First, you must fill the form. It is online and easy to find on the college website.

  • Entrance Exams: Then, some colleges take a test. The test may ask questions on Maths and Computers.

  • Merit List: After the test, they make a list. This list shows who can join, based on marks and test scores.

  • Counseling: After that, students attend a counseling round. This helps them pick a college and course they like.

  • Seat Confirmation: Finally, you pay the fee to book your seat in the course.

So, follow these steps one by one. Read the college rules and dates early to avoid any trouble.

 

Top Entrance Exams for BSc Information Technology Degree in India:

To join top BSc IT colleges, students must clear some entrance exams. These exams help colleges pick students with strong maths and computer skills. Let’s look at the main ones:

  • Joint Entrance Examination (JEE) – IT: This is a big exam in India. It has questions on Maths and Computer Science.

  • Common Admission Test (CAT): Some IT courses accept it, though it’s mainly for management. It tests maths and data skills.

  • NIMCET (NIT MCA Common Entrance Test): It is for MCA, but some BSc IT colleges use it. It checks maths, logic, and computer knowledge.

  • BITSAT: This is for BITS Pilani. It has questions on Maths, Physics, and Chemistry.

So, if you do well in these tests, you can study in top colleges. These exams help you build a strong IT career from the start.

 

BSc Information Technology Course Fees:

Knowing the course fee is important for students and parents. The cost for BSc IT may change from one college to another. This is because every college is different.

Some colleges have better teachers, big labs, and more tools to learn. Because of that, they may charge more. Most of the time, fees can be between INR 50,000 to 2,00,000 each year.

But, before you choose a college, check what it offers. Look at the teachers, labs, and real-world learning. A good college will give more value, even if the fee is high.

 

BSc Information Technology: Subjects & Syllabus:

The BSc IT course is made to give students a clear idea of how IT works. It covers many subjects. Let’s look at the main ones:

Software Development:

  • Programming Languages (C, C++, Java): Learn to code in popular programming languages.

  • Software Engineering Principles: Know the steps to build strong software.

  • Web Development (HTML, CSS, JavaScript): Learn to make smart websites using these tools.

  • Mobile App Development: Explore how apps are made for phones and tablets.

Networking:

  • Computer Networks: Study how computers talk to each other.

  • Network Security: Know how to keep networks safe from bad users.

  • Wireless Communication: Learn how data moves without wires.

  • Data Communication: See how data travels inside computer systems.

Database Management:

  • Database Design: Learn to build strong and safe databases.

  • SQL (Structured Query Language): Practice asking and saving data using SQL.

  • Data Warehousing and Mining: Study how big data is stored and used.

  • Big Data Technologies: Know tools that handle huge data sets.

Cybersecurity:

  • Cyber Threats and Attacks: Learn about online dangers and how to stop them.

  • Cryptography: Study simple ways to lock and unlock secret data.

  • Network Security Protocols: Use rules that help to keep networks safe.

  • Ethical Hacking: Learn good ways to test whether systems are safe.

System Analysis and Design:

  • Systems Development Life Cycle (SDLC): Know how to plan and build a system in steps.

  • Requirement Analysis: Learn to ask what users need from the software.

  • UML (Unified Modeling Language): Use pictures to show how software works.

  • Software Architecture: Understand how large software systems are built.

So, all these subjects help students learn many things in IT. Step by step, they gain skills for the real world.

 

Why Studying BSc Information Technology is Important?

Studying for a BSc in IT is helpful in many ways. Let’s look at why it matters:

  • Relevance to the Digital Age: Today, the world runs on technology. So, this course helps students stay up-to-date.

  • Versatility of Skills: This course teaches many skills. Students learn to code, manage data, and build safe networks.

  • Industry Demand: Technology is growing quickly. Many companies need skilled IT workers.

  • Innovation and Problem-Solving: Students learn to solve real problems in clever ways. They develop skills for practical situations.

  • Global Opportunities: After students finish this course, they can work abroad. This allows them to explore new job options.

Therefore, this course is not just about learning. It’s a way to shape the future and bring new ideas to life.

 

Salary after BSc Information Technology Course in India:

Knowing the salary after BSc Information Technology is helpful. It helps students and job seekers plan well. The salary depends on your skills, job type, and the company.

Most freshers get a salary between INR 3.5 lakh and 9 lakh every year.

Job Roles and Salary Range:

  • Software Developer: You will build and test new software programs. Salary Range: INR 4 lakh to 7 lakh per year.

  • Network Administrator: You will manage and fix computer networks. Salary Range: INR 3.5 lakh to 6 lakh per year.

  • Database Administrator: You will create and look after big data systems. Salary Range: INR 4 lakh to 8 lakh per year.

  • Cybersecurity Analyst: Stop online attacks and secure data. Salary Range: INR 5 lakh to 9 lakh per year.

  • System Analyst: You will plan smart IT tools to help businesses. Salary Range: INR 4.5 lakh to 8 lakh per year.

So, these jobs offer good pay. They give students many chances to grow in the IT world.

 

Future Scope of BSc Information Technology Degree in India:

BSc Information Technology has a promising future in India. There are good jobs in both the government and private sector.

The Scope in Government Sector:

  • Public Sector Undertakings (PSUs): Many government-owned firms need IT staff. You can work in software, network setup, or safety roles.

  • Government Agencies: Some government offices handle digital work. They hire IT graduates for tasks like data control and website work.

Scope in Private Sector:

  • IT Companies: Many top IT firms need smart workers. They offer jobs in coding, testing, and managing projects.

  • Tech Startups: Startups are new and full of ideas. They offer exciting jobs in new tech tools.

  • Scope in Overseas: Many countries need good IT workers. So, students with a BSc in IT can even work abroad. They can find jobs in top global companies.

Thus, the BSc IT degree gives students many career options. They can work in India or even in other countries.

 

Career and Job Opportunities after BSc Information Technology Degree:

After a BSc in Information Technology, students have various career options. Let us now look at the top job options:

  • Software Developer: You will make and test new computer programs. You will help in building smart tools that people use every day. Want to know more? Read how to become a software engineer after 12th.

  • Network Administrator: You will manage the office computer network. This job helps all systems run without any break.

  • Database Administrator: You will store and manage lots of data safely. Your job will make sure the data is safe and easy to use.

  • Cybersecurity Analyst: Stop hackers and protect systems. As the world goes digital, this job becomes important.

  • System Analyst: You will study business needs and build IT plans. You help teams use the right tools to do better work.

  • IT Consultant: You will give smart advice to companies. Your tips will help them use technology in the best way.

  • Technical Support Engineer: You will solve problems and fix tech issues. You help people when they face trouble with their systems.

List of Government Jobs Opportunities After BSc Information Technology Degree Course:

There are good jobs in the government for IT graduates:

  • UPSC Civil Services: You can join various departments after passing UPSC exams.

  • State Public Service Commissions: State jobs offer IT roles. These include managing digital tasks.

  • Railway Recruitment Board (RRB): You can work for Indian Railways. Your job will be to manage computer systems.

  • Bank Probationary Officer (PO): Many banks hire IT graduates. They manage their digital platforms.

  • Defense Services: You can work in the army. Your job will be to protect data and network systems.

So, government jobs offer both safety and a good future for IT students.

List of Private Jobs Opportunities After BSc Information Technology Degree Course:

Private companies give great chances to BSc IT graduates:

  • IT Companies: Big names like TCS, Infosys, and Wipro hire for many roles.

  • Multinational Corporations (MNCs): IBM, Microsoft, and Google offer global-level IT jobs.

  • Startups: New tech firms need smart people for fresh and creative ideas.

  • E-commerce Companies: Amazon and Flipkart seek IT staff for online security tools.

  • Telecommunication Companies: Airtel, Jio, and Vodafone recruit for networks and data.

  • Consulting Firms: Accenture and Deloitte offer tech advice to companies.

  • Financial Institutions: Banks and finance companies need IT teams for their applications. They need support for security.

So, private jobs are many and help students find work in many industries.

 

Top Companies Hiring BSc Information Technology Graduates:

Getting a job in a good company can make your future strong. Let’s look at the best ones:

  • Tata Consultancy Services (TCS): Offers jobs in software, IT help, and consulting.

  • Infosys: Gives work in coding, testing, and helping other companies.

  • Wipro: Offers software jobs and helps in solving tech problems.

  • IBM: A global firm that works in cloud, AI, and data work.

  • Microsoft: Hires people for software and cloud service roles.

  • Accenture: Gives jobs in tech, digital, and business planning.

  • Google: Hires smart minds for AI, apps, and machine learning jobs.

So, these top firms help students grow and learn modern tech skills fast.

 

Required Skills for BSc Information Technology Degree Course:

To do well in the IT field, students need both tech and soft skills. Let’s look at the main skills every BSc IT student should have:

  • Programming Skill: You should know how to write code. It is good to learn simple languages like C, C++, Java, or Python. These help in building software.

  • Networking Knowledge: You must understand how computers talk to each other. So, you should know about networks, settings, and internet rules.

  • Problem-Solving: You will face problems. But if you can think clearly, you can fix them fast. This skill is useful in IT jobs.

  • Communication Skills: You must speak and write clearly. This helps you work better with your team and share ideas with others.

  • Cybersecurity Awareness: Today, there are many online threats. That is why you must know how to keep computer data safe.

  • Adaptability: New tools and apps come every day. So, you must be ready to learn and use them quickly.

  • Analytical Thinking: Study data to identify issues. This helps you fix problems and build better systems.

These skills help BSc IT students get good jobs and grow in the fast-changing tech world.

 

Certificate Courses after BSc Information Technology Degree:

After finishing BSc IT, you can do extra courses. These short courses teach special skills. Let us look at some good ones:

  • Certified Ethical Hacker (CEH): This course teaches how to stop hackers. So, you learn to protect systems safely.

  • AWS Certified Solutions Architect: This course helps you understand cloud services. You learn to work with Amazon Web Services (AWS).

  • Certified ScrumMaster (CSM): Here, you will learn how to manage projects. The methods are simple and fast. It helps when you work in teams.

  • Oracle Certified Professional (OCP): This course teaches how to handle big data. It uses Oracle tools to manage and store that data.

  • Cisco Certified Network Associate (CCNA): This course teaches you about computer networks. You will get to work with Cisco devices.

These courses are short but useful. They give extra skills and make BSc IT students better prepared for jobs.

 

BSc Information Technology or BSc Computer Science Degree, Which is Better?

Many students feel confused when they must choose between BSc IT and BSc Computer Science. But if we look at the good points of each, the choice becomes easy.

Advantages of BSc Information Technology:

  • Versatility: This course covers many topics. So, you will learn about networks, data safety, and database handling.

  • Practical Orientation: You get to work on real tasks. This helps you use your classroom learning in real-life jobs.

  • Industry-Relevant Skills: The course teaches skills that are used in companies. Because of this, you become ready for work.

Advantages of BSc Computer Science:

  • Deep Technical Knowledge: This course gives you strong knowledge about how computers work. So, you learn about rules, steps, and data methods.

  • Software Development Emphasis: You learn a lot about making software. This is great if you want to become a software developer.

  • Theoretical Foundation: The course teaches you the “why” behind things. This helps if you want to study more or do research.

Both degrees are good in their own way. So, you should choose the one that matches your likes and career dreams.

 

How to Choose Top BSc Information Technology College?

Choosing the best college is important. A good college helps you grow and learn well. So, finds some points to help you choose:

  • Accreditation:
    First, check if the college is approved. This is important because it shows the college follows good teaching rules.

  • Faculty Expertise:
    Next, look at the teachers’ experience. Good teachers make a big difference. They help you learn better and clear doubts easily.

  • Infrastructure:
    Also, make sure the college has computer labs, internet, and a library. With these, you can study without problems.

  • Industry Exposure:
    Besides that, check if the college offers internships and company visits. These things help you see real work closely.

  • Placement Records:
    Then, find out if students from that college get jobs. Also, check what companies come and what they pay.

  • Curriculum and Specializations:
    After that, read the course details. Some colleges offer special topics. So, choose the one that matches your goals.

  • Research Opportunities:
    Moreover, check if the college offers small research projects. You may also learn about tech events and fairs.

  • Student Reviews and Feedback:
    Finally, try to talk to old or current students. They will help you know how the college really is.

In short, choosing the right college is the first big step. If you follow all these points, you will surely make a smart choice.

 

Top Colleges in India for BSc Information Technology

  • St. Xavier’s College, Mumbai:
    This college is one of the top colleges in India. Also, it offers good teaching and gives great learning tools for BSc IT.

  • Christ University, Bangalore:
    Christ University has smart teachers. Moreover, it helps students learn both theory and real-life computer work.

  • Loyola College, Chennai:
    Loyola is known for good labs and strong computer courses. So, it helps students get ready for jobs.

  • Symbiosis Institute of Computer Studies and Research, Pune:
    This college offers good IT courses. In addition, it helps students with placements after study.

  • Madras Christian College (MCC), Chennai:
    MCC gives a great learning space. Also, it has smart teachers and helpful study material.

  • Fergusson College, Pune:
    It is old and famous. Besides that, it offers BSc IT with both theory and lab work.

  • Mithibai College, Mumbai:
    This college is known for smart teachers. Moreover, it gives students chances to work on live computer projects.

  • Jai Hind College, Mumbai:
    Jai Hind offers good BSc IT courses. Apart from that, it supports learning through clubs and activities.

  • Ramnarain Ruia College, Mumbai:
    This college offers a good mix of theory and practice. So, it helps students grow skills for jobs.

  • DG Ruparel College, Mumbai:
    It gives strong BSc IT programs. In addition, it holds workshops to teach new computer skills.

  • Amity University, Noida:
    Amity offers BSc IT with modern labs. Also, it helps students get jobs in big IT companies.

  • Lovely Professional University (LPU), Punjab:
    LPU is known for its big campus and labs. Moreover, it offers support for student projects and job training.

  • VIT, Vellore:
    VIT has a smart campus and strong computer labs. Because of this, it gives students global exposure.

 

Top FAQs:

Q1. What is BSc Information Technology?

It is a 3-year degree about computers and technology. It teaches coding, data, and networks. So, you learn how tech works.

Q2. Who can study BSc Information Technology?

Any student who passed 12th with science or math can join. If you like computers, this is a good course.

Q3. Is BSc IT a good course?

Yes, it is a good course. Because of this, it gives many job options in the IT field.

Q4. What jobs can I get after BSc IT?

You can work as a software developer, data analyst, or IT support. So, there are many paths to choose.

Q5. What is the salary after BSc IT?

Starting salary is between ₹2.5 to ₹5 lakh per year. As you grow, it increases with experience.

Q6. What are the subjects in BSc IT?

It includes programming, databases, networks, web design. In this way, you learn many useful things.

Q7. Can I do BSc IT without math?

Some colleges allow it. However, many need math in 12th class.

Q8. What is the difference between BSc IT and BSc Computer Science?

BSc IT focuses on using tech tools. On the other hand, BSc CS teaches deep computer rules and logic.

Q9. Is there any entrance exam for BSc IT?

Some colleges take direct admission. But sometimes, a few may have an entrance test.

Q10. Can I do MCA after BSc IT?

Yes, you can study MCA. In fact, it will help you grow in your career.

Q11. Is BSc IT better than BCA?

Both are good. But, BSc IT has more tech parts, while BCA is more about coding.

Q12. Which are the best colleges for BSc IT?

St. Xavier’s Mumbai, Christ University, and Loyola College are top choices. So, you have good options.

 

Key Takeaway:

In the end, doing a BSc in Information Technology is a smart choice. Because of this, it helps you build a strong base and also teaches special skills. So, you can work in areas like software, networks, or online safety.

Moreover, this course prepares you for many jobs. In fact, companies in India and abroad look for such people. As a result, this degree will always stay useful, especially when the world of computers grows fast.

While you start your BSc IT journey, do not stop being curious. Instead, try to learn more each day. After all, you must be ready for change, as new things keep coming.

With that in mind, if you work hard and stay passionate, you can grow well in this field. So, keep learning and reach for great success in the world of computers.

With a unique blend of artistic flair and communication expertise, Pratik Singh stands out as a senior content writer whose words have the power to captivate and inspire. Armed with dual master's degrees in Arts and Communications, he brings a multifaceted perspective to his writing, seamlessly weaving together the realms of academia and creative expression.

Continue Reading

Trending